首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 31 毫秒
1.
面向对象技术在海洋工程实时采集系统中的应用   总被引:3,自引:3,他引:0  
面向对象(OO)技术是一种与传统的软件开发方法截然不同的方法,近年来得到很快发展。讨论了OO技术特点,和如何将OO技术在海洋工程实时采集系统中实现。初中证明,应用此项技术而开发的海洋工程实时采集程序是稳定、可靠、方便和实用的。  相似文献   

2.
随着AOP日益广泛的应用,几乎所有的OO语言都进行了面向方面的扩展,然而这些语言无法实现对非正交方面的有效表达,方面调节模式通过一组类实现了联结器的基本任务,在该编程模式下能使用通用OO语言支持AOP,同时它的分层应用模式支持更大粒度的方面描述,能作为各种轻量级AOSD框架的基础,其简洁性和扩充性也能适应面向对象软件的方面挖掘工程的需要。  相似文献   

3.
面向对象的OOA、OOD软件开发技术分析   总被引:1,自引:0,他引:1  
面向对象是当前计算机界关心的重点,是上个世纪90年代软件发展的主流,实际上,面向对象的概念和应用已经超越程序设计和软件开发,而且已经渗透到了系统模拟、数据库、多媒体、图形技术、网络管理系统、CAD技术、人工智能等多个领域。文章主要讨论面向对象的开发方法OOA和OOD,并且对面向过程与面向对象加以比较,阐述了面向对象的OOA、OOD之不足及适用范围,同时也分析了发展中存在的争论问题。  相似文献   

4.
在软件操作类课程教学中,向学生直观地展示软件的操作步骤和过程是非常必要的。目前,采用现场操作演示的方式进行教学是软件操作类课程教学的常规方式,但是其有着一些无法克服的致命缺陷,屏幕录像技术因此应运而生。本文阐述了屏幕录像课件的概念内涵和优势,屏幕录像课件的录制要点及其应用前景。  相似文献   

5.
面向对象数据库是面向对象技术与数据库技术相结合的产物,面向对象的数据模型把客观世界模拟成相互作用的对象的集合,每个对象具有唯一标识,存储在数据库中的对象被称为永久对象;每一个对象的定义包括状态和行为(界面)两个方面,状态由一组属性值组成,行为由一组操作组成.本文主要探讨面向对象数据库的编译技术.  相似文献   

6.
为了适应并促进软件无线电应用系统的发展,提出一种基于系统体系(SystemOfSystem,SOS)的概念和面向对象思想的设计方法。通过对软件无线电系统体系和面向对象设计方法特性的分析,确定使用面向对象设计方法的合理性。以一个简要的软件无线电系统体系设计为例,使用系统建模语言(SystemModelingLanguage,SysML),介绍面向对象设计具体步骤。  相似文献   

7.
根据面向对象技术的三层设计模式方法,将优化设计中各种对象抽象为三类——图形用户界面类、问题域类和数据访问类,构建优化设计软件系统;采用面向对象程序设计语言开发优化软件系统,具有易于扩展和维护的特点,避免优化设计软件的开发人员的重复工作。  相似文献   

8.
给出了Java内部类(Inner Class)的定义,在对其分类研究的基础上,分析了成员类、局部类和匿名类的基本特性、约束规则和引用方法,给出了各种内部类的使用方法、访问控制和应用实例。使用内部类简化了程序设计,符合信息隐藏原则,提高了程序的安全性、可理解性和运行效率。在Java面向对象技术(Object-Oriented Technique,OOT)教学与应用开发中收到了好的效果。  相似文献   

9.
对在MIS系统的开发中应用面向对象方法(OO)的一些问题作了说尽的探讨,提出了一咱新的概念;OO对象在管理应用方面的生命周期-管理对象生存周期(MOLC),对应用该思想在面向对象的MIS开发中的分析及设计方法作了探讨,对于不支持面向对象的DBMS平台,给出了基于面向对象思想的基本设计方法。  相似文献   

10.
许多人认为面向对象慨念和关系型数据库相互不一致,并且不能结合。事实上完全相反!经过灵活的使用,一个关系型数据库能够为面向对象(OO)模型提供一套优秀的实现。同样的模型能够用来开发关系型数据库结构。也有人把面向对象的数据库设计(即数据库模式)思想与面向对象数据库管理系统(OODBMS)理论混为一谈。其实前者是  相似文献   

11.
分析了OO方法在软件复用中的应用,利用OO方法的基本特性、OO程序设计的基本过程实现软件复用,讨论了在OO方法中实现软件复用、典型的OO方法UML中的软件复用。  相似文献   

12.
随着面向对象开发思想广泛应用到大规模的软件中,相应的对面向对象软件测试技术也提出了新的更高的要求.面向对象软件测试技术与传统软件测试相比,在测试步骤上基本相同,但是测试的思想截然不同,它的测试重点放在了类的测试问题上,与传统的单元测试相对应.因此,重点研究和探索了在类测试阶段,对于基于OSD动态状态测试模型的构造方法及其应用.  相似文献   

13.
长期以来,我们总是参考现向过程的测试方向来测试利用面向对象技术开发的软件,效果并不理想,尤其是组装阶段的测试。因为类具有继承性(Inheritance)和多态(Polymorphism)/动态联编性(Dynamic binding),并不等于面向过程设计中的模块。因此,要取得更好的测试效果,只有找到与之相适应的面向对象的组装测试技术方可。  相似文献   

14.
面向对象作为建立在"对象"概念基础上的方法学,已被广泛应用于软件开发的各个阶段,尤其在数据库开发中应用面向对象技术可以使需求分析者和设计者的应用理解达成一致,缩短开发周期,提高产品质量.本文基于面向对象的技术特点,针对关系数据库的应用方法进行探讨,并以某图书管理系统为例进行分析.以期通过本文的阐述使程序员能够更好的利用面向对象技术,以一种更加自然的方式与底层数据库中的数据打交道.  相似文献   

15.
软件复用与面向对象技术   总被引:2,自引:0,他引:2  
软件复用是软件工程思想中的三个基本策略(复用、分而治之、折衷)之一。本文首先明确软件复用的概率,而后分析了软件复用的现状,分析阐述了面向对象技术是一个非常实用且强有力的软件开发方法。  相似文献   

16.
统一建模语言(Unified Modeling Language)已经成为面向对象软件开发方法的主要技术.利用面向对象思想,借助UML可视化建模技术,来描述开发CPC(协作产品商务)软件的基础模块建模过程,可大大增加拟开发系统的稳定性和成功可能.  相似文献   

17.
钟泽秀 《考试周刊》2012,(26):140-141
本文分析了面向对象(OOP)编程思想的不足,提出了一种新型编程思想——面向方面(AOP),通过对AOP技术的研究和应用,验证了面向方面编程思想在软件开发中的先进性和可行性。  相似文献   

18.
目前各种主要的面向对象语言都进行了面向方面的扩展以支持AOP,由于联结器对语义和语法结构的限制,这些语言不提供对非正交方面的支持,提出了方面联结器的形式化定义,并依此实现了通用OO语言的AOP支持,该模式的归纳定义方式支持更大粒度的方面表达,能作为各种轻量级AOSD框架的基础,同时其简洁性和可扩充性适合面向对象软件的方面挖掘工程的需要。  相似文献   

19.
UML(统一建模语言)是面向对象技术的一个重要应用,也是近代软件工程环境中对象分析和设计的重要工具。通过理论及应用研究,阐述了软件体系结构与UML之间的关系。  相似文献   

20.
本文介绍一种用于大规模软件维护的工具,即注释系统(PROMPTER) ,它可为汇编语言程序生成注释,包括汉化注释,它采用面向对象方法,把硬件和程序设计知识描述为类实例定义。面向对象描述以层次方式分解和组织知识,它表明许多约定如数据定义是理解系统程序的主要障碍。这些约定在这个框架中可很好地规范化。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号